I. ¿Qué es el agente SOCKS5?
Antes de empezar a introducir la configuración del proxy SOCKS5 y la práctica de su aplicación, entendamos primero qué es el proxy SOCKS5.El proxy SOCKS5 es un protocolo de transporte de red que establece una conexión segura entre un cliente y un servidor, permitiendo al cliente reenviar sus peticiones de red a través de la conexión y evitando la comunicación directa con el servidor. En términos sencillos, es como construir un puente entre tu ordenador y el servidor a través del cual puedes conectarte a Internet protegiendo tu privacidad.
Segundo, pasos de configuración del agente SOCKS5
Veamos paso a paso cómo configurar un proxy SOCKS5 en Linux.
1. Instalación del software Privoxy
Privoxy es una excelente herramienta para convertir proxy SOCKS5 a proxy HTTP para nuestro sistema Linux. En primer lugar, tenemos que instalar el software Privoxy a través de la herramienta de gestión de paquetes. Ejecute el siguiente comando en el terminal:
sudo apt-get install privoxy
2. Configuración de Privoxy
Una vez completada la instalación, necesitamos hacer algunos cambios en el archivo de configuración de Privoxy. Edita el archivo de configuración `/etc/privoxy/config` y encuentra las siguientes líneas:
“`
# Es necesario eliminar el símbolo de comentario #
# Habilitar agente SOCKS5
conf_file /etc/privoxy/forwards/forward-socks5.conf
“`
A continuación, guarde para salir.
3. Creación del archivo forward-socks5.conf
Ejecute el siguiente comando para crear y editar el archivo `forward-socks5.conf`:
sudo touch /etc/privoxy/forwards/forward-socks5.conf
sudo nano /etc/privoxy/forwards/forward-socks5.conf
En el archivo abierto, añada lo siguiente:
# Introduzca la dirección y el número de puerto de su servidor proxy SOCKS5.
forward-socks5 / 127.0.0.1:1080 .
Tenga en cuenta que `127.0.0.1:1080` es la dirección y el número de puerto del servidor proxy, cámbielos en consecuencia.
4. Iniciar el servicio Privoxy
Introduzca el siguiente comando para iniciar el servicio Privoxy:
sudo service privoxy restart
En este punto, la configuración del proxy SOCKS5 está completa.
III. Aplicación práctica del agente SOCKS5
Con la configuración anterior en su lugar, ahora estamos listos para aplicar realmente el proxy SOCKS5.
1. Instalar el cliente ipipgo
En primer lugar, necesitamos instalar el cliente ipipgo localmente para conectarnos al servidor proxy SOCKS5. Ejecute el siguiente comando en el terminal para instalar el cliente ipipgo:
sudo apt-get install
2. Edite el archivo de configuración ipipgo
Ejecute el siguiente comando para editar el archivo de configuración ipipgo:
sudo nano /etc/.json
En el archivo abierto, rellene la siguiente configuración:
{
"servidor": "tu_servidor_ip",
"puerto_servidor": 8388,
"local_address": "127.0.0.1",
"local_port": 1080,
"contraseña": "tu_contraseña",
"timeout": 300,
"método": "aes-256-cfb"
}
donde `su_ip_servidor` es la dirección IP del servidor proxy SOCKS5, y `8388` es el número de puerto del servidor proxy, que debe cambiarse según la situación real. Su_contraseña` es la contraseña para conectarse al servidor proxy, que también debe cambiarse en función de la situación real.
3. Inicie el cliente ipipgo
Introduzca el siguiente comando para iniciar el cliente ipipgo:
sslocal -c /etc/.json -d start
4. Verificar la configuración del proxy
Ejecute el siguiente comando en el terminal para ver la conexión de red actual:
curl ipinfo.io
Si la salida muestra la misma dirección IP que `your_server_ip`, entonces el proxy SOCKS5 está funcionando y ahora te estás conectando a Internet a través de la red proxy.
La protección de la privacidad y el control de acceso para la comunicación en red se puede lograr utilizando el proxy SOCKS5, que es muy útil para escenarios en los que se necesita proteger la privacidad o romper las restricciones de acceso. Espero que este artículo te haya sido útil y que sigas aprendiendo más sobre tecnologías de red y explorando más conocimientos interesantes.